If the control has gone into lockout due to excessive tank temperature (four flash, 3 second pause) reset the control by rotating the gas control knob to “OFF” position. Then follow the lighting instructions and return the gas control knob to the desired setpoint.

Observe the water heater operation. If the gas control continues to lockout due to excessive tank temperature, proceed to thermal sensor and harness testing to determine the cause.

THERMAL SENSOR AND

HARNESS TESTING Position the gas control knob to the “OFF” position and disconnect the thermal sensor harness from the gas control.

Using a multi-meter set to the Ohms setting, determine the resistance of thermal sensor .

(see caution photos at right)

CAUTION

DO NOT use standard multimeter probes for this test. Doing so will damage connector. Use special pin type electronic probes or small diameter wire pins inserted into connector.

Using a multi-meter set to the ohms setting, insert one meter probe (see caution) into center wire position of thermal well connector, insert the second probe (see caution) into either of the outside wire positions (see photo on left).

Alternate the probe on the outside position to the opposite outside wire position (see photo on right).
